Question 75133: A picture is 4 inches longer than it is wide. It is surounded by a mat that is 2 inches wide. The total area of the mat is 112 square inches. If w is the width of the picture, which equation is true.
(w+4)(w+8)+w(w+4)=112
(w+2)(w+6)-w(w+4)=112
(w+4)(w+8)-w(w+4)=112
(w+2)(w+6)+w(w+4)=112

The area of the picture and mat is; (w+4) (the width of the picture plus the mat, which is 2 inches on each side), multiplied by (w+4+4 or w+8) (the length of the picture plus the mat)
The difference in these two areas is the area of the mat itself (112) so (total area)-(area of picture)=(area of mat)
or (w+4)(w+8)-w(w+4)=112......looks like equation 3 is the winner
